Novatium launches pay-as-you-use based computing applications services over broadband
TT Correspondent |  New Delhi |  01 Oct 2008

Novatium Solutions announced the launch of Nova Navigator, a pick and choose computing applications service provided over broadband.

 

“The Navigator hardware box through a broadband connection allows the user to access applications residing on our servers and pay for just those applications. The product can be used even outside India as it is a plug-and-play device and just needs a broadband connectivity,” said Mr Alok Singh, CEO of Novatium.

 

The Navigator device is priced at Rs 5,999 and the subscription for services start at Rs 100 per month.
